Isaiah 21

  • 1. This message came to me concerning the land of Babylonia: Disaster is roaring down on you from the desert, like a whirlwind sweeping in from the Negev.
  • 2. I see an awesome vision: I see you plundered and destroyed. Go ahead, you Elamites and Medes, take part in the siege. Babylon will fall, and the groaning of all the nations she enslaved will end.
  • 3. My stomach aches and burns with pain. Sharp pangs of horror are upon me, like the pangs of a woman giving birth. I grow faint when I hear what God is planning; I am blinded with dismay.
  • 4. My mind reels; my heart races. The sleep I once enjoyed at night is now a faint memory. I lie awake, trembling.
  • 5. Look! They are preparing a great feast. They are spreading rugs for people to sit on. Everyone is eating and drinking. Quick! Grab your shields and prepare for battle! You are being attacked!
  • 6. Meanwhile, the Lord said to me, "Put a watchman on the city wall to shout out what he sees.
  • 7. Tell him to sound the alert when he sees chariots drawn by horses and warriors mounted on donkeys and camels."
  • 8. Then the watchman called out, "Day after day I have stood on the watchtower, my lord. Night after night I have remained at my post.
  • 9. Now at last--look! Here come the chariots and warriors!" Then the watchman said, "Babylon is fallen! All the idols of Babylon lie broken on the ground!"
  • 10. O my people, threshed and winnowed, I have told you everything the LORD Almighty, the God of Israel, has said.
  • 11. This message came to me concerning Edom: Someone from Edom keeps calling to me, "Watchman, how much longer until morning? When will the night be over?"
  • 12. The watchman replies, "Morning is coming, but night will soon follow. If you wish to ask again, then come back and ask."
  • 13. This message came to me concerning Arabia: O caravans from Dedan, hide in the deserts of Arabia.
  • 14. O people of Tema, bring food and water to these weary refugees.
  • 15. They have fled from drawn swords and sharp arrows and the terrors of war.
  • 16. "But within a year," says the Lord, "all the glory of Kedar will come to an end.
  • 17. Only a few of its courageous archers will survive. I, the LORD, the God of Israel, have spoken!"
